Compact and Portable

A treadmill that folds is a great option for those who want to exercise at home. Contrary to conventional treadmills that fold they can be easily put away when not in use by simply folding them up and releasing space. They are also smaller which makes them ideal for smaller spaces.

While the ability to fold a treadmill allows users to incorporate fitness into their routines, there are some disadvantages to consider. They may require regular maintenance and repairs due to the fact that they are folded and unfolded frequently. This could result in decreased performance, stability, and lifespan.

Folding treadmills can also be a concern because of the shorter stride and absence of incline adjustments. These limitations can impact the user's natural running and walking style, which may lead to numerous injuries over time. These limitations can cause a problem for the user to maintain a good body posture. This can put stress on joints and back.

In this regard, it's crucial to select a well-made treadmill when purchasing the folding model. Experts suggest settling for an established, durable brand. This will not only guarantee that the treadmill is constructed for long-term use but also lower the chance of breakdowns and malfunctions resulting from the constant wear and tear.

Users should also look for treadmills with easy-to-use controls and are clearly marked. These features will allow users to get the most out of their workouts without having to spend long hours learning how to operate the machine. A foldable treadmill incline workout's maintenance requirements are also important to consider. These models are usually designed for portability and space saving, so they are less feature-rich than models that don't fold. This means they're more likely be subject to wear and tear than other treadmills, so make sure to go through reviews and carefully evaluate specifications before buying.

The majority of the top treadmills that fold are able to maintain a steady running speed of 12 or even 10 mph. They are perfect for those who wish to maintain their fitness on the go. But it's always best to confirm the treadmill's continuous horsepower (CHP) rating, as this is the metric that indicates how well the treadmill can keep up with your runs and jogs.
